Grouting template structure for hinge joint of prestressed concrete hollow slab girder
The invention relates to a prestressed concrete hollow slab girder hinge joint grouting formwork structure which comprises a hanging formwork (2) matched with a slab girder hinge joint (1a), the hanging formwork (2) is connected with a slab girder (1) through a hanging bolt (3), the hanging formwork (2) is provided with a pair of parallel pasting adhesive tapes (4), the pasting adhesive tapes (4) are symmetrically arranged on the two sides of the hanging formwork (2) in the length direction, and a piece of formwork cloth (5) is arranged between the two pasting adhesive tapes (4). The pasting adhesive tape (4) is made of rubber materials, the thickness of the pasting adhesive tape (4) is larger than that of the formwork cloth (5), the lower end of the hanging bolt (3) is connected with the clamping pin (6), and the upper end of the hanging bolt (3) is connected with the tensioning and fixing device (7). The method has the advantages that the filling compactness of the bridge plate bottom hinge joint grouting material is improved, slab staggering of the beam plate bottom hinge joint is reduced, the appearance quality problem of the bridge plate bottom hinge joint and the bottom of a plate beam is fundamentally solved, and the long-term durability of the plate beam hinge joint is improved.
